How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Merriam Park East?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Merriam Park East Studio Apartments | $1,284 | $850 | $5,058 |
Merriam Park East 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,710 | $1,113 | $4,860 |
Merriam Park East 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,107 | $570 | $10,000+ |
Merriam Park East 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,957 | $720 | $3,008 |
Merriam Park East 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,077 | $620 | $3,200 |

Getting Around the Merriam Park East Neighborhood in Saint Paul, MN
Walk Score®
84 / 100
Very Walkable
Most err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
79 / 100
Very Bikeable
Biking is convenient for most trips
Transit Score®
54 / 100
Good Transit
Many nearby public transportation options
What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
